Overview

Sue Ross Recruitment are working on behalf of our client, a highly respected law firm, who are expanding and require both Employment Law Paralegals and Solicitors.

Responsibilities
  • assessing employment cases
  • negotiating and advising on settlement agreements
  • handling claimant employment tribunal claims up to and including litigation and advocacy
  • responsible for handling their own caseload

You will deliver excellent levels of client service and keep the client regularly updated in line with department service level agreements and individual targets.

You will be responsible and accountable for promptly handling all matters related to assessing claims, giving both verbal and written telephone advice, running Employment Tribunal claims, drafting ET1 claims and other Tribunal applications and conducting litigation, instructing and liaising with counsel, conducting hearings where appropriate and negotiating, advising on settlement agreements and COT3 proceedings, providing employment law training and supervising junior staff and representing the firm at events.

Qualifications
  • Employment Law experience, as a Paralegal, Legal Executive or Solicitor
  • Dealing with a large and varied ET caseload, advice work and settlement agreements (claimant experience preferred)
  • Excellent knowledge & understanding of employment law
